Product Description
Conceived, engineered and built with precision in the United Kingdom, VXP Series
represents a brand new evolution in Tannoy’s core philosophies in self-powered
loudspeaker design. The Tannoy VXP 12.2Q features the brand new IDEEA™
(IntelliDrive Energy Efficient Amplifier) integrated power module from Lab.gruppen
The result is an ultra-reliable and efficient, self-powered loudspeaker offering a punchy
and sonically superior solution for medium-scale sound reinforcement. The VXP 12.2Q
has been sonically matched with the wider range of VXP Series models, this allows
consistency in installations where a mix of products is utilised.
The VXP 12.2Q is built around two discrete transducers, 1 x 300 mm (12”) PowerDual™
with Q-Centric waveguide and a 1 x 300 mm (12”) bass driverfor greatly improved LF
extension, mounted within a compact rugged birch plywood cabinet with aesthetically
profiled edges and an Airnet
TM
-backed, powder-coated steel grille. The latest higher
power handling 300 mm (12”) version of Tannoy’s exclusive point source, constant
directivity PowerDual drive unit technology, coupled with the QCW device, brings
best of both worlds – true point source acoustical performance combined with highly
controlled 75 x 40 degree dispersion, resulting in less unwanted shading effects and
optimized forward gain. The driver assembly can be rotated 90 degrees in the cabinet
to allow for versatile mounting without compromise to dispersion requirements.
The perfectly matched integrated Lab.gruppen IDEEA (IntelliDrive Energy Efficient
Amplifier) modules are designed to handle the demands of fixed installation audio,
with the inherent extended duty cycles of around-the-clock operation and very high
performance demands, while offering the durability, unmatched power output and
clarity required by portable applications. To ensure a long and trouble-free service
life, IDEEA modules incorporate extensive features to safeguard internal circuits and
driver compliment.
At the heart of the IDEEA module is a patented Class D output stage capable of high
power levels with very low distortion and minimal current draw – all with a net operating
efficiency in excess of 80%. A universal switching power supply accepts any mains
voltage from 70 – 265V (+/- 10%) at 50 Hz or 60 Hz through the appropriate IEC cord.
In Auto mode, the speaker turns on with signal present and switches to standby mode
after 20 minutes of no input, in doing so reducing power consumption to less than 1 W
(while in standby). Manual control mode allows the speaker to be turned on and off as
required. Also provided is a switchable 90 Hz high-pass filter for use when adding
a subwoofer.
Audio connection is via XLR Input and power via PowerCON (included) on rear panel.
VXP 12.2Q is available in black or white textured paint finish as standard, with
matching grilles, and is also available in custom matched RAL colours as an option.
Features
Applications
• Theatres, Auditoria and Houses of Worship
• Medium scale PA.
• Bars and nightclubs
• Portable and installed corporate AV
• Theme parks and leisure venues
• Gymnasiums and small/medium sports arenas
• Cinemas
• 300 mm (12”) PowerDual full-range driver with
QCW™ delivering best of both worlds – true point
source combined with new horn design allowing
tight vertical coverage.Discrete 300 mm (12”) bass
driver for extended LF performance.
• Well defined 75 x 40 degree dispersion for
optimum coverage and forward gain
• Peak output of 131 dB
• Integrated Lab.gruppen IDEEA module
providing ultra-reliable Class D amplification
• Versatile mounting via optional custom-
designed hardware
• Available in black or white textured paint finish;
custom colours optional
• XLR input and link, powerCON mains (included)
